Dear Colleagues, We are pleased to announce that the First Backward-Angle (u-channel) Physics Workshop will be held September 21-22 at Jefferson Lab, Newport News, VA. The objectives of the workshop are as follows: * Offer a platform to connect scattered experiment and theory efforts together, thus, potentially forming small backward-angle physics working groups. * Generate discussions on the implications the backward-angle physics and probe the physics case for a systematic backward-angle physics research program. * Inspire future backward-angle physics data mining or dedicated studies, including the JLab 12 GeV program, and PANDA/FAIR. * Discuss the feasbility of including backward-angle physics in the EIC scientific program. The scientific program is expected to comprise roughly 15 talks, followed by a group discussion on the Tuesday afternoon, which we hope can lead to an eventual white paper on u-channel physics.
